Demagogic In Webster's Dictionary

\Dem`a*gog"ic\, Demagogical \Dem`a*gog"ic*al\, a. [Gr. dhmagwkiko`s: cf. F. d['e]magogique.] Relating to, or like, a demagogue; factious.
